To match a hotspot to an existing shape:
1. Draw the hotspot as described above, and create the shape as
described in Drawing and editing shapes on p. 303.
2. Select both objects and choose Fit Hotspot to Shape from the Tools
menu. The hotspot region is matched to the outline of the shape. On
publishing, only the shape responds to a cursor hover over.
The hotspot and shape will still be separate, so you can easily delete
the shape if it's no longer needed once you've used it as a template
to produce a hotspot of a desired shape.
To modify a hotspot hyperlink:
Using the Pointer Tool, double-click the hotspot.
The Hyperlinks dialog appears with the current hotspot link target shown.
To modify the hyperlink, select a new link destination type and/or
target.
To remove the hyperlink, change the link destination to No
Hyperlink.
